Activity of Mesoporous Alumina Particles for Biomass Steam Reforming in a Fluidized-Bed Reactor and Its Application to a Dual-Gas-Flow Two-Stage Reactor System

Pulverized sugar cane bagasse (SCB) and cedar sawdust (CSD) were rapidly pyrolyzed and reformed in situ with steam in a laboratory-scale fluidized-bed reactor at temperature of 973−1123 K and steam-to-biomass mass ratio (S/B) of 0−3.5. A substantial portion of the nascent tar was converted into coke...
